Jake’s Initial Love Island Experience: Series 7 (2021)
Jake, a water engineer from Weston-super-Mare, entered the Love Island villa on day one of series seven. From the outset, he coupled up with Liberty Poole, a marketing student from Birmingham. Their relationship became a central storyline of the season, evolving from initial attraction to a seemingly deep connection that saw them become the first official couple of the series.
Key moments and talking points from Jake’s time in Series 7:
Early Coupling and “Official” Status: Jake and Liberty quickly became a fan-favorite couple. Their journey to becoming boyfriend and girlfriend was well-documented and celebrated by viewers who saw genuine affection between them.
Casa Amor Controversy: Like all couples on Love Island, Jake and Liberty faced the ultimate test of Casa Amor. While both remained loyal in terms of recoupling, Jake’s interactions with the other boys, encouraging them to explore connections with the new arrivals, drew criticism from viewers who perceived his actions as hypocritical given his seemingly solid relationship with Liberty.
Movie Night Fallout: The infamous Movie Night, where the Islanders are shown clips of each other’s behavior, proved to be a turning point for Jake and Liberty. Footage of Jake admitting he wasn’t initially physically attracted to Liberty and expressing doubts about their relationship caused significant friction and led Liberty to question his sincerity.
The “I Love You” Dilemma: Liberty confessed her love for Jake, but his hesitation and delayed reciprocation raised further doubts among viewers and Liberty herself about the depth of his feelings. When he did eventually say “I love you,” some questioned whether it was genuine or simply what Liberty wanted to hear.
Growing Doubts and the Breakup: As the final approached, Liberty voiced increasing concerns about the authenticity of their relationship. She felt that Jake might be more invested in staying in the villa and winning than in their connection. In a tearful conversation just days before the final, Liberty ended their relationship, stating she didn’t believe he loved her for who she was.
Joint Departure: In a shocking turn of events, Jake and Liberty decided to leave the villa together shortly after their breakup. They felt that their journey as a couple had ended, and neither wanted to stay in the villa without the other in a romantic capacity. Jake cited that he couldn’t “fake things for the sake of being in here.”
Reunion Absence: Jake was notably absent from the series seven reunion episode, citing illness. This further fueled speculation and prevented a direct on-screen interaction with Liberty post-villa.

Based on online information, Jake’s activities post-Love Island include:
Charity Work: Reports indicate that Jake has dedicated time to supporting dog charities, reflecting his love for his own dog, Lennie. He has spoken about wanting to “give something back” and using his platform to raise awareness for causes close to his heart.
Online Community Building: Jake has reportedly set up an online group for his followers, aiming to create a “safe space” for communication and support. This suggests a desire to connect with his audience beyond the realm of reality television.
Exploring Other Career Paths: While many former Islanders pursue further reality TV opportunities or influencer careers, Jake has hinted at other interests. He has expressed a dream of working on a show involving dogs, indicating a passion that extends beyond the typical post-Love Island trajectory.
Addressing Public Perception: Jake has spoken about the negative comments and “hate” he received during and after his time on Love Island. He has acknowledged that it affected his family and friends more than himself, emphasizing his “thick-skinned” nature.
Occasional Media Appearances: While not constantly in the spotlight, Jake has occasionally given interviews and made appearances related to his Love Island experiences.
